Căutați un mediu de dezvoltare web performant, care să funcționeze fără probleme pe sistemele dvs. Macbook, PC Windows și Linux? Atunci ar trebui să acordați o șansă CodeLobster! Acesta este un mediu avansat pentru dezvoltare PHP/HTML/CSS/JavaScript, echipat cu numeroase funcții și un suport excelent pentru multiple platforme.
CodeLobster a fost lansat recent și pentru Linux, dar, oficial, suportă doar distribuțiile Ubuntu și Debian. Totuși, cu puțină îndemânare, vă vom arăta cum să-l utilizați și pe alte distribuții, precum Arch Linux, Fedora și OpenSUSE. Să începem!
Instrucțiuni pentru Ubuntu/Debian
Instalarea aplicației CodeLobster pe Ubuntu și Debian este simplă, deoarece dezvoltatorii oferă suport oficial pentru Linux printr-un pachet DEB. Pentru a începe instalarea CodeLobster pe Ubuntu sau Debian, deschideți o fereastră de terminal. Apoi, accesați site-ul web al dezvoltatorului.
Odată ce ați încărcat site-ul, căutați butonul „Descărcare” și selectați-l pentru a ajunge la link-urile de download pentru CodeLobster pe Linux.
Veți vedea mai multe opțiuni de descărcare pentru CodeLobster. Căutați pachetul numit „codelobsteride-1.5.1_amd64.deb” și selectați-l pentru a iniția descărcarea.
După ce pachetul DEB s-a descărcat pe calculatorul dvs. Ubuntu sau Debian, reveniți la fereastra terminalului. Utilizați comanda CD pentru a schimba directorul de lucru din directorul personal (~) în folderul „Descărcări”.
cd ~/Downloads
Acum că vă aflați în directorul „Descărcări”, puteți instala CodeLobster utilizând instrumentul dpkg.
sudo dpkg -i codelobsteride-1.5.1_amd64.deb
Dacă instalarea pachetului se realizează cu succes, este important să utilizați comanda apt install sau apt-get install pentru a rezolva eventualele probleme de dependență care ar fi putut apărea în timpul instalării.
sudo apt install -f
Sau, pentru Debian:
sudo apt-get install -f
Cu dependențele rezolvate, CodeLobster este gata de utilizare pe Ubuntu sau Debian!
Instrucțiuni pentru Arch Linux
Dezvoltatorii instrumentului de dezvoltare CodeLobster nu intenționează să ofere suport pentru sistemul de operare Arch Linux. Acest lucru este de înțeles, deoarece majoritatea dezvoltatorilor preferă să ofere suport doar pentru Ubuntu/Debian.
Din fericire, este destul de simplu să dezasamblați pachetul DEB al CodeLobster pentru a-l utiliza pe Arch Linux. Mai mult, deoarece toate bibliotecile necesare pentru rularea CodeLobster sunt incluse în pachetul DEB, acesta ar trebui să funcționeze corect în majoritatea cazurilor.
Pentru a începe instalarea CodeLobster pe Arch Linux, instalați instrumentul de conversie Alien cu următoarele comenzi:
sudo pacman -S git base-devel rsync
git clone https://github.com/trizen/trizen
cd trizen
makepkg -sri
trizen -S alien_package_converter
Acum că instrumentul Alien este configurat, este timpul să descărcați pachetul DEB al CodeLobster. Pentru a face acest lucru, accesați site-ul web al dezvoltatorului, faceți clic pe „Descărcări”, apoi pe link-ul „codelobsteride-1.5.1_amd64.deb”.
După descărcarea pachetului DEB, deplasați-vă cu CD în directorul „Descărcări”.
cd ~/Downloads
Utilizând Alien, convertiți pachetul într-un fișier TGZ.
sudo alien -tvc codelobsteride-1.5.1_amd64.deb
Apoi, creați un director de extracție folosind mkdir și dezarhivați fișierul TarGZ cu comanda tar.
mkdir -p ~/Downloads/code-lobster-files
mv codelobsteride-1.5.1.tgz ~/Downloads/code-lobster-files/
cd ~/Downloads/code-lobster-files
tar zxvf codelobsteride-1.5.1.tgz
În cele din urmă, instalați programul pe Arch Linux folosind Rsync.
sudo rsync -a usr/ /usr
sudo rsync -a opt/ /opt
Instrucțiuni pentru Fedora/OpenSUSE

Puteți rula CodeLobster pe Fedora sau OpenSUSE Linux dacă convertiți pachetul DEB furnizat de dezvoltatori într-un fișier pachet RPM.
Pentru a face acest lucru, trebuie mai întâi să instalați convertorul de pachete Alien. Puteți găsi informații despre cum funcționează pe SUSE sau Fedora Linux, accesând această postare aici.
Odată ce aveți Alien pe computerul Fedora sau SUSE, este timpul să descărcați pachetul CodeLobster DEB. Pentru aceasta, accesați site-ul dezvoltatorului și faceți clic pe „Descărcați”, apoi pe link-ul etichetat „codelobsteride-1.5.1_amd64.deb”.
Deschideți o fereastră de terminal și utilizați comanda CD pentru a muta terminalul în directorul „Descărcări”.
cd ~/Downloads/
De aici, apelați instrumentul de pachete Alien și convertiți pachetul CodeLobster DEB într-un fișier RPM. Asigurați-vă că ignorați orice avertismente care apar; acestea nu ar trebui să afecteze procesul de construire.
sudo alien -rvc codelobsteride-1.5.1_amd64.deb
Convertirea unui pachet DEB într-un RPM durează ceva timp. Când procesul este finalizat, este timpul să începeți instalarea pentru Fedora și OpenSUSE.
În timpul instalării CodeLobster, va trebui să forțăm instalarea. Programul funcționează bine, singura problemă este că, pe unele distribuții, refuză să instaleze o dependență, chiar dacă nu are nevoie de ea.
Pentru a ocoli problema dependenței, putem folosi comanda rpm, în loc de instrumentul DNF al Fedora sau Zypper al OpenSUSE.
sudo rpm -Uvh --nodeps codelobsteride-1.5.1-2.x86_64.rpm --force
Lăsați comanda RPM să ruleze. Când este gata, CodeLobster va fi pregătit pentru utilizare pe Fedora sau OpenSUSE!